New data released on April 13 shows a total of 23,375 new permanent residents were welcomed to Canada in February.
According to recent data from Immigration, Refugees, and Citizenship Canada (IRCC), including the 24,665 permanent residents welcomed in January, a total of 48,040 have obtained permanent residency in the first two months of the year alone. For comparison, Canada was able to welcome 50,600 new immigrants in the first two months of 2020.
Prior to the pandemic, Canada was able to welcome between 25,000 to 35,000 permanent residents a month.
As Canada continues to recover from the pandemic, it can be expected that the IRCC’s data release results for March 2021 will be markedly better than last year’s. Immigration has stabilized dramatically since the disruption caused by the announcement of the COVID-19 pandemic in March of 2020.
It is likely that the trend of a large number of new permanent residents being welcomed into the country every month will continue, as the IRCC has also remained consistent in sending out invitations to Express Entry applicants in the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) and Canadian Experience Class (CEC). Candidates from these categories have an easier time accomplishing the permanent residency application as they are already likely to have settled in Canada.
As of this announcement, Canada continues to remain on track to accomplishing their goal of welcoming 401,100 new immigrants this 2021. While the IRCC is currently focused on inviting candidates who have already settled in the country, economic immigration is still a high priority. Once the global situation regarding the coronavirus improves, the IRCC may restart draws for the Express Entry categories focused on foreign skilled workers.
